The 2013 Philippines National Yo-yo Contest was held in Manila on November 10th, unfazed by typhoon Haiyan.
This year all defending champions successfully retained their titles!
In 1A, Crucial’s dancing wonder Reymark Zavalla got his second title in a row, ahead of Miguel Fernando and Joseph Junsay. 2A saw Kyle Capiral win once again to claim his sixth national title, Hiro “Kitty” Koba remains the king of Filipino 3A, Duncan’s hyperactive duo Sean Perez and Bryan Jardin also defended their titles in 4A and 5A, claiming their seventh (!!) and sixth titles, respectively.
